Perhaps decay has an ordering effect in that it evens out time and reduces its transit to a level that is present and perceptible. The manufacture of an object is "prima facie" an act of creation, the creation of order and yet it necessarily also implies destruction and decay. Whether an object is finished, perfect or completed is only a matter of appearance. All material, living or not, is undergoing a process that, one way or another, ends in destruction and disorder.
